41、e with IECLicensee=Boeing Co/5910770001 Not for Resale, 01/31/2009 01:45:38 MSTNo reproduction or networking permitted without license from IHS -,-,- 62499 IEC:2008 5 RAILWAY APPLICATIONS CURRENT COLLECTION SYSTEMS PANTOGRAPHS, TESTING METHODS FOR CARBON CONTACT STRIPS 1 Scope This International Sta

42、ndard gives rules for testing methods for carbon contact strips. The purpose of this standard is to demonstrate that the carbon contact strip construction, by attachment to integral supporting structure (carrier) but excluding bolted assembly, is fit for purpose. Not all tests may be relevant to som

43、e designs. 2 Normative references The following referenced documents are indispensable for the application of this document. For dated references, only the edition cited applies. For undated references, the latest edition of the referenced document (including any amendments) applies. None. 3 Terms a

44、nd definitions For the purposes of this document, the following terms and definitions apply. 3.1 carbon contact strip strip of carbon material, permanently attached to an integral supporting structure (carrier) but excluding bolted assemblies 3.2 shear strength stress at failure of the adhesion betw

45、een carbon and the support structure 3.3 autodrop detection sensor mechanism incorporated in the carbon contact strip to provide the indication for the pantograph automatic dropping device (ADD) 3.4 flow continuity uninterrupted flow of air or other fluid 3.5 rated current loading current value defi

46、ned by the manufacturer that the carbon strip is designed to sustain without degradation under the specified operating conditions 4 Symbols and abbreviations A designed area of adhesion (mm2) FS shear force (N) Copyright International Electrotechnical Commission Provided by IHS under license with IE

47、CLicensee=Boeing Co/5910770001 Not for Resale, 01/31/2009 01:45:38 MSTNo reproduction or networking permitted without license from IHS -,-,- 6 62499 IEC:2008 R resistance () s shear strength (N/mm2) 5 Tests 5.1 General There are two categories of tests: type tests, routine tests. The above tests are

48、 described in 5.1.1 to 5.1.2. Supplementary tests may be required if they have been specified in the customer specification and after agreement with the supplier. Annex A summarises the tests which shall be performed. 5.1.1 Type tests Type tests shall be performed on a single piece of product of a given design.
